Defining Catastrophic Injuries and Their Impact

Catastrophic injuries are severe physical damages that lead to long-lasting impairments, such as spinal cord injuries, traumatic brain injuries, amputations, or severe burns. These injuries drastically alter a person’s lifestyle, often requiring extensive medical care and assistance with daily activities. Understanding the nature and consequences of catastrophic injuries is crucial in pursuing appropriate legal remedies, as compensation must reflect the full extent of the individual’s needs and losses over time.

Key Terms and Glossary for Catastrophic Injury Cases

Familiarity with common legal terms can help clients better understand their claims and the legal process. The following glossary provides definitions of key terms relevant to catastrophic injury cases to assist in navigating complex legal language.

Catastrophic Injury

A catastrophic injury refers to a severe injury that results in long-term or permanent disability, significantly affecting an individual’s ability to perform daily activities and maintain a normal quality of life.

Damages

Damages are the monetary compensation sought by the injured party to cover losses such as med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future care costs related to the injury.

Liability

Liability refers to the legal responsibility of a party for causing injury or harm to another, which must be established for a successful claim.

Settlement

A settlement is an agreement between the injured party and the responsible party or insurer to resolve the claim without going to trial, often involving payment of compensation.

In California, the statute of limitations for filing a personal injury claim, including catastrophic injury cases, is generally two years from the date of the injury. It is important to act promptly to preserve your rights and avoid missing critical deadlines. Consulting with an attorney early can help ensure all necessary paperwork is filed on time and that your case is handled effectively. Early action also facilitates thorough evidence collection and stronger claim preparation.

California follows a comparative fault rule, meaning your compensation may be reduced by the percentage of your fault in the injury. Even if you are partially responsible, you can still recover damages proportional to the other party’s liability. Understanding how fault affects your case is important, and legal guidance can help protect your rights and optimize your claim outcome.
